Keeping with January’s theme, The Blank Page and How to Face It, this week’s DLP art challenge was to work with gesso so I decided to do a gesso resist using Dylusions Spray.
I started by sponging on a layer gesso over a couple of different stencils onto my pages. I used Mosaic Swirl and Swirly Garden.
Once the gesso was dry, I sprayed my pages with Dylusions in Vibrant Turquoise, Bubblegum Pink and Fresh Lime.
The gesso resists most of the spray, allowing the stenciled design to come through.
I stamped a border using Dylusions stamps and some doodles, and did a bit of random stamping to add a bit more layering.
I stamped Collaged Hearts, by Dina Wakley, onto book paper, cut them out and adhered them with gel medium.
I also added a few pieces of gelli plate transfer tape that I’d previously made.
